"This is the film version based on the 1968 Off-Broadway play and with that production's original cast of actors. And they are excellent. The plot revolves around a birthday party among a small group of gay friends and the uninvited guest who may or may not be gay. Kenneth Nelson stars as Michael, a 40-ish gay man who is probably a lapsed Catholic and feels a sense of guilt for being gay, based on his religious upbringing. π‘ Did You Know?
Stars all of the same actors from the original play. Producer/author Mart Crowley insisted that the entire original cast of the off-Broadway production be used in the film.
